Grandson of Queen Elizabeth has a girl

QUEEN Elizabeth, 84, became a great-grandmother for the first time when the wife of her grandson Peter Phillips gave birth to a baby girl, Buckingham Palace said yesterday.

Autumn Phillips, a Canadian, gave birth on Wednesday. "The Queen, the Duke of Edinburgh, the Princess Royal, Captain Mark Phillips and Autumn's family have been informed and are delighted with the news. The baby's name will be confirmed in due course," it said.

Peter Phillips is the only son of the Princess Royal, Princess Anne, and her first husband Mark Phillips. He was the first grandchild of the Queen to marry despite constant speculation about some of her other grandchildren Prince Harry, Prince William and Phillips's sister Zara.

Her birth also made Zara an aunt. The royal family said last week that Zara, an equestrian athlete, was to marry rugby player Mike Tindall.
